Can my bank get me a refund?

The chargeback process lets you ask your bank to refund a payment on your debit card when a purchase has gone wrong. You should contact the seller first, as you cannot start a chargeback claim unless you have done this. Then, if you can’t resolve the issue, get in touch with your bank.

Can we refund in debit card?

When you make a debit card purchase, the money is transferred out of your bank account to the merchant. The bank cannot issue an immediate refund to your debit card because the process is instant, and your money is no longer there. If you need a refund, you must contact the merchant to process the request for a refund.

Can you claim money back on a debit card?

Debit card payment protection and chargeback

Debit card payments and purchases are not covered by section 75 of the Consumer Credit Act. But you might be able to make a claim for a refund under a voluntary scheme called ‘chargeback’. This might cover purchases of any value made on debit, credit or prepaid cards.

How long can a refund legally take?

You can get a full refund within 30 days. This is a nice new addition to our statutory rights. The Consumer Rights Act 2015 changed our right to reject something faulty, and be entitled to a full refund in most cases, from a reasonable time to a fixed period (in most cases) of 30 days.

Why are tax refunds taking so long?

A manual review may be necessary when a return has errors, is incomplete or is affected by identity theft or fraud. Even though the Internal Revenue Service issues most refunds in less than 21 days for taxpayers who filed electronically and chose direct deposit, some refunds may take longer.

How long does it take to get your tax refund direct deposit?

within 21 days
If all goes well and you file electronically and choose direct deposit for your refund — the fastest way — your money should arrive in your bank account within 21 days, according to the IRS. The IRS says it is prioritizing returns with refunds over those where a taxpayer owes money to Uncle Sam.
